About Captivation Software
Sourced by ZipRecruiter
Company size
11 - 50 Employees
Headquarters location
Baltimore, MD, US
Year founded
2014
Annapolis Junction, MD
$130K - $270K/yr
Full-time
Medical, Dental, Vision, Life, Retirement, PTO
Posted 12 hours ago
Captivation has built a reputation on providing customers exactly what is needed in a timely manner. Our team of engineers take pride in what they develop and constantly innovate to provide the best solution. Captivation is looking for software developers who can get stuff done while making a difference in support of the mission to protect our country.
Captivation Software is looking for a software engineer to provide customer support and infrastructure services with quick response capabilities for SIGINT and Cyber Solutions.
RequirementsThis position is open for direct hires only. We will not consider candidates from third party staffing/recruiting firms.
Sourced by ZipRecruiter
11 - 50 Employees
Baltimore, MD, US
2014
Software Engineer 2
Software Engineer 3
Software Engineer 1
Software Engineers
Engineer Software Engineering
Software Engineering
Computer Software Engineer
It Software Engineer
Software Developer
Software Engineering Specialist
Full Stack Python Developer Salaries
Full Stack Python Developer Career Research
Q: What skills or qualities help someone succeed as a Software Engineer?
A: To succeed as a Software Engineer, key technical skills include proficiency in programming languages such as Java, Python, or C++, as well as expertise in software development methodologies like Agile and version control systems like Git. Additionally, strong problem-solving skills, attention to detail, and the ability to learn and adapt quickly are essential soft skills, along with effective communication and collaboration skills to work with cross-functional teams. These technical and soft skills enable Software Engineers to design, develop, and maintain high-quality software applications, driving career growth and effectiveness in the role.
Q: What is the career path for a Software Engineer?
A: A Software Engineer's typical career progression involves starting as a Junior Software Engineer, where they focus on coding and contributing to existing projects, then advancing to a Mid-Level Software Engineer role, where they take on more complex tasks, lead smaller projects, and mentor junior team members. As they gain experience, they can move into Senior Software Engineer positions, where they lead large-scale projects, architect software systems, and make technical decisions that impact the organization. With continued growth, Software Engineers can pursue leadership roles, such as Technical Lead or Engineering Manager, or transition into specialized areas like DevOps, Product Management, or Technical Consulting.